Today we drove to Bellevue, MI to witness the annual fall migration of thousands of Sandhill Cranes. Turn on your sound to listen to their calls, which can be heard up to 2.5 miles away.
These magnificent #birds nearly disappeared a century ago due to overhunting, but populations rebounded & are now stable in MI.
Sandhill Cranes are among the oldest living birds on Earth with a wingspan of up to 6 ft. Aldo Leopold described them as "nobility, won in the march of eons."

Be ungovernable, like birds who make nests OUT OF ANTI-BIRD SPIKES. A new study describes resourceful Dutch & Belgian corvids besting evil architecture by stealing metal anti-bird strips and using them like thorny twigs, to construct their homes.
Like thorns, the spikes may protect their nests from predators.

For ~50 years, these flightless #birds were presumed extinct, but they were rediscovered in 1948.
Today there are less than 500 takahē left, but numbers have been increasing through successful conservation measures.
